Hello

Running Firefox 48.0 on Windows XP SP3

while copying firefox profile to backup location, get "Error Copying File or Folder" "Cannot remove folder 212167069elm_adbn.files: The filename or extension is too long".

Anyone seen this before and know how to fix it?

Thank You

I believe that most folders ending in .files are usually for storing cookies or other website specific data. If you trace the file path for that folder, it usually is located inside of a folder called http+++[Website Address].com, which denotes which website that data is related to.

Nevertheless, you shouldn't have any issues with your backup profile if you choose not to backup those files.

If you do want to attempt to move those files, ensure that Firefox is completely closed and that you are logged into an administrator account.
